⚾ HBC Hammer high school teams end season in Goddard; 15U runner up

Posted Jul 18, 2022 2:47 AM

GODDARD – The HBC 15U Hammer ended their season Sunday with a runner-up finish in the 15/16U division of the High School Elite Series Tournament at the Genesis Sports Complex. After avenging a pool play loss to the Great Bend Bombers with a victory in the semifinals, the Hammer lost in extra innings to the Wichita Wolfpack 9-8 in the finals.

In the title game, the Hammer (14-14-1) rallied from a six-run deficit to force extra innings. They scored five in the fifth then tied the game with a run in the sixth on a Jalen Smith single.

Tournament rules have extra innings starting with one out and the last three outs from the previous inning on base.

The Hammer scored a run on a groundout. The Wolfpack tied the game with a walk then scored the winning run on a groundout.

Trace Jacobs and C Lindenmeyer both drove in two runs for Hays. Jacobs made the start on the mound and pitched three innings. Jonathan Cano pitched the final 4 1/3 innings and suffered the loss.

The Hammer finished 1-1 in Saturday’s pool play, losing 22-2 to the Great Bend Bombers then beating the Wichita Falcons 8-1. They then beat the HBC Hammer 16U 10-0 in their bracket opener Saturday night.

They knocked off the Bombers 7-6 in the semifinals. They broke a 2-2 tie with two runs in the fifth and three in the top of the sixth. The Bombers scored four in the bottom of the sixth but left the tying run at second when the game ended because or time limit.

16U wins consolation bracket

The 16U Hammer (14-16-2) bounced back from their loss to the 15U with a pair if wins Sunday to win the consolation bracket. The 16U knocked off the Mulvane Wildcats 7-2 then rallied to beat the Falcons 9-6.

The Hammer trailed 6-2 in the consolation final then scored two in the fourth and three in the sixth and seventh. Dylan Haselhorst and Brett Schumacher both had three hits. Haselhorst homered and Schumacher two doubles.

Tanner Boxberger pitched four scoreless innings of relief and picked up the win.

The 16U went 1-1 in pool play before losing to the HBC 15U in the bracket opener Saturday night.

18U ends season with win

The 18U Hammer (22-14) went 1-3 in the tournament. They lost on a walkoff hit 3-2 to 316 Elite – Torres then 15-6 to the Wichita Aeros – Oldenburg in Saturday’s pool play. In bracket play, Sunday they lost 8-5 to the Wichita Aeros – Buseman-Mann then beat the Buhler National 5-3.

Carson Spray (5-1) pitched a complete game three-hitter against Buhler. Spray struck out five and walked three with all three runs unearned.

Spray also went 2-for-2 with two RBIs at the plate.

In their first game Sunday, the Hammer rallied from an early two-run deficit with three in the fifth to take a one-run lead but the Aeros scored six in the top of the seventh.

Derick Riggs and Will Cadoret both had two hits including home runs.
